Robbins-Gioia Board Appoints Michael L. Sledge President and COO; Jim Leto Leaves to Become President and CEO of GTSI

ALEXANDRIA, Va.--Feb. 1, 20067, 2006--Robbins-Gioia, LLC, the leading provider of program management services, today announced that its board of directors has named Michael L. Sledge as the company's president and chief operating officer. Jim Leto, who most recently served as Robbins-Gioia president and CEO, will remain closely connected with the company and retain his seat on the Robbins-Gioia board.

Most recently, Sledge was Robbins-Gioia's president for civilian agencies and homeland security. In 2005, his organization's revenues surpassed those of the defense division for the first time in the company's 25-year history. Robbins-Gioia got its start in providing PM services to the DOD, long a mainstay of the company's business, making this significant achievement even more remarkable. Sledge has held increasingly responsible positions at Robbins-Gioia since joining the company in 1984. His hands-on approach to client engagements--whether working with senior government officials to implement business processes and systems to support strategic planning, portfolio management, capital planning, and enterprise program management, or working with his team to implement bonuses based on customer evaluations of performance--has earned him praise from both groups.

Sledge holds a bachelor of sciences in business administration from Duquesne University and is a Project Management Professional certified by the Project Management Institute. Sledge is approved by the Association of Professionals in Business Management as a Certified Business Manager. He is a member of the Project Management Institute, the American Defense Preparedness Association and the Armed Forces Communications and Electronics Association. Sledge also serves as a guest speaker on capital planning and performance-based contracting.

Robbins-Gioia thrived under Leto's three-year leadership with record profits in 2005. "Under Mike's leadership, Robbins-Gioia will be positioned for even greater things as the company moves into the future," said Leto.

"I am profoundly honored to be chosen for this position," said Sledge. "Robbins-Gioia is a great company with great people. With this team, I know we can help our customers and our own employees achieve even greater heights of success."

About Robbins-Gioia, LLC

Robbins-Gioia has been dedicated to delivering management consulting solutions to government agencies and Fortune 500 companies for 25 years. Robbins-Gioia combines thought leadership, disciplined processes, industry-based knowledge, and integrated tools to help global customers optimize their business processes, accelerate change, and establish time, cost, and quality improvements to transform their businesses.
